Dormitorio ridículamente automatizado

Tome tres radios NRF24L0 +, dos Arduino Nanos y una Raspberry Pi. Agregue un estudiante aburrido y un dormitorio en Rice University. Lo que obtienes es el RRAD: Rice Ridiculically Automated Dorm. [Jordan Poles] construyó un sistema modular inspirado en BRAD (el dormitorio ridículamente automatizado de Berkeley).

RRAD tiene tres tipos de nodos:

  • Nodos de acción: permite aceleradores externos como relés o solenoides
  • Nodos sensoriales: informa datos de sensores (luz, temperatura, movimiento)
  • Nodos en la nube: panel de control de alojamiento, registra datos, proporciona interfaces de datos externos
  • El hub también permite [Jordan] controlar las cosas con su teléfono Android a través de Tasker. Tiene el código Arduino y Raspberry Pi en GitHub si quieres automatizar ridículamente algo propio. Sin embargo, probablemente quieras adaptarlo a tu dormitorio, casa o caravana.

    [Jordan] continúa trabajando en el proyecto y pronto promete tener reconocimiento de voz y otras funciones. Nos ocupamos de muchos proyectos de domótica, incluidos algunos descritos como ridículos. El siguiente video muestra a BRAD, la inspiración para RRAD.

    • Ben dice:

      ¡Mira ese video! ¡Salte a 3:20! ¡Esto es ridículo!

      • Tomás dice:

        Me recordó a http://www.plasma2002.com/epb/ 🙂

    • Andrés dice:

      Lo que no me gusta de la mayoría de estos sistemas es la interfaz de usuario de pantalla basada en listas. Algunos amigos y yo tenemos un proyecto automatizado basado en nRF24L01 +, etc.con una arquitectura genial, protocolos y demás (https://la-tecnologia.io/project/4210-sensorino) pero la interfaz de usuario es importante al final del día. Quiero ver los controles distribuidos espacialmente en cualquier mapa, 2D o 3D o por pisos o lo que sea, o lógicamente en un árbol y fácilmente navegables y haciendo que el estado de cada elemento sea inmediatamente obvio. En una pantalla holográfica o incluso como un modelo a escala física del sitio como en algún viejo post de la-tecnologia.
      El sensor funciona mal en su mayoría fuera de mi casa, ya que hay un grupo en MakeSpace Madrid que está construyendo la mejor automatización ridícula de hackspace automática que hayas visto, y con suerte tendremos pantallas táctiles (a través de las tabletas Android de $ 25) en cada pared con un gran usuario. interfaces para cada habitación. que puede pellizcar-hacer zoom para ver hacia afuera.

      • TacticalNinja dice:

        ¿Estás diciendo que el desarrollador no puede mejorar más la IU?

    • jpoles1 dice:

      ¡Qué agradable sorpresa ver mi trabajo presentado en Hack-a-day! Este no es un proyecto terminado (ni pulido); más bien, todo el asunto de este trabajo era proyectar / desarrollar repetidamente y mejorar constantemente mi sistema cuando tenía tiempo.

      Teniendo en cuenta que soy un estudiante universitario con viviendas inconsistentes (me muevo entre apartamentos y habitaciones dentro de mi edificio), debo tener un sistema que sea modular, portátil y capaz de operar en muchos ambientes o arreglos de habitaciones diferentes. También necesito mantener mis costos bajos (realmente bajos).

      Desearía tener tiempo para escribir más sobre mi trabajo en el sistema de automatización, pero no tengo tiempo suficiente para codificar uno. Estoy tratando de documentar la mayor parte de mi trabajo en este momento en mi blog (http://jpoles1.github.com/blog/), y espero escribir una publicación de blog sobre mi trabajo en la última versión de RRAD pronto. ¡Lo publicaré también en la página de mi proyecto!

      • DV82XL dice:

        > “Considerando que soy un estudiante universitario con una vida inconsistente (me mudo entre apartamentos y habitaciones dentro de mi edificio)”

        Tenía curiosidad por eso.

    • jioasge dice:

      Podría haber pegado un asiento de inodoro a la pared, habría sido más bonito y más razonable. Y no hay necesidad de emitir aún más radiación de 2,4 GHz, es dañina porque calienta el agua, eso es su cuerpo, sus ojos, cerebro, testículos y otras cosas menos importantes.

      • jwrm22 dice:

        La razón por la que un microondas usa 2.4 GHz es porque su licencia es gratuita, casi cualquier otra frecuencia funcionaría también. La diferencia entre un puñado de chips NRF24 * y un microondas es la potencia de salida. Un microondas doméstico es de alrededor de 800W. Los transmisores de 2,4 GHz son de 1 a 10 mW.

      • jpoles1 dice:

        Me pregunto si sabes que WiFi, junto con algunas otras tecnologías modernas ubicuas, incluido Bluetooth, también emite esta frecuencia de radiación (con una potencia de salida mucho mayor). Algunos monitores para bebés incluso utilizan 2,4 GHz; oh humanidad, ¿por qué a los estadounidenses no les importa más el microondas de sus bebés? Quizás vivas en una gran jaula de Faraday si quieres estar protegido de los efectos dañinos de la radiación electromagnética.

        Ahora, mirando la estética de este proyecto, seré el primero en admitir, “maldita sea, esto es feo”. Ojalá tuviera más tiempo para pulirlo.

        • Cola de pato 911 dice:

          ¿Es usted una de esas personas que también se preocupa por el monóxido de dihidrógeno? ¿Te das cuenta de que todos los estudios doble ciego realizados sobre el efecto percibido de las ondas WiFi en las personas han aparecido con las manos vacías?

          • Doug metzler dice:

            Me gusta la idea de un cochecito de Faraday.

      • mcnugget dice:

        No sé si estás tratando de ser serio o gracioso aquí. Se necesita MUCHA energía en un espacio reducido para calentar agua por radio.

    • Luis dice:

      Entonces, cuando estás en modo fiesta, no puedes apagarlo: P

    • timgray1 dice:

      http://iot-playground.com/

      Ya es fácil hacer esto con las capacidades de IoT si es necesario. Funciona muy bien y Pi puede hacer todo el levantamiento de pesas bastante bien. También agregaron recientemente soporte para dispositivos externos para usar wifi a través de ESP8266

    • anónimo dice:

      ¡Usar luz ultravioleta en la habitación de un estudiante de primer año parece una muy mala idea!

      • emnov dice:

        ^ esto; D

      • Sotavento dice:

        ¡DECIR AH! Como alguien que pasó mucho tiempo de fiesta en los dormitorios de la Universidad de Rice a principios de los 70, puedo asegurarles que esta no es la primera vez que se ven luces negras en los dormitorios de la Universidad de Rice que se utilizan con fines festivos …

    • LordRaven dice:

      RRR-Repost

    • RyanNorton dice:

      Mi mayor problema con los grandes sistemas automatizados distribuidos como este es cómo mantener bajos los controladores para cada dispositivo individual. ¿Utiliza un controlador inalámbrico para hablar con varios controladores inalámbricos? Aunque me gusta la idea de que todos los elementos sean inalámbricos para facilitar su uso, desde el punto de vista del costo y de Internet, me molesta. Tengo curiosidad por saber cómo conectaste todo y te comunicaste.

      • jpoles1 dice:

        Hola Ryan, este es un problema en el que he estado pensando mucho. Creo que es importante mantener baja la complejidad para el cuidado y la portabilidad, pero la tecnología inalámbrica es definitivamente esencial para la adaptabilidad. Anteriormente mencioné que “soy un estudiante universitario con una vida inconsistente (me muevo entre apartamentos y habitaciones dentro de mi edificio)”, lo que significa que necesito poder configurar mi sistema con casi cualquier configuración de redes eléctricas, muebles, electrodomésticos. etc. La tecnología inalámbrica me permite hacer esto de manera agradable y sencilla.

        El costo no es un gran problema, ya que muchas radios cuestan actualmente alrededor de $ 3-5 (consulte NRF24L01 o ESP8266) y se pueden comprar incluso más baratas. En términos de comunicación, mi arreglo no fue ideal. Usando los chips NRF24L01, tenía un concentrador central que emitía comandos y recibía datos de sensores, mientras que los nodos tomaban comandos o enviaban datos de sensores. En un diseño ideal, creo que se podría usar una topología de malla, con nodos individuales que reciben y repiten la información que escuchan. Con esta estrategia, cuantos más chips / nodos NRF24L01 haya implementado, más robusta será su red (según tengo entendido). Puede obtener más información sobre esta red en línea a través de NRF24L01 aquí (https://github.com/TMRh20/RF24Mesh) y aquí (https://www.youtube.com/watch?v=2EgpG2kjCQc). Nunca tuve la oportunidad de probarlo yo mismo, pero creo que este enfoque promete mucho.

    • Pulseman dice:

      De acuerdo, casi esta configuración exacta será mi proyecto final en sistemas integrados, simplemente reemplace los Arduino Nanos con Teensy LCs (un poco abrumado pero bueno)

      Nunca tuve la oportunidad de terminarlo, me alegro de ver al menos la idea factible. ¡Buen espectaculo!

    • jpoles1 dice:

      Publiqué el primero de una serie de artículos de trabajo sobre la última versión de mi proyecto (usando el reconocimiento de voz para dominar un dormitorio). Espero que lo compruebe si está interesado:
      http://jpoles1.github.io/blog/2016/02/28/The-Automation-Expmt/

Maya Lorenzo
Maya Lorenzo

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*